Transaction 3c66d69ffcca4fcf1b5f577695526226d076829db11d4d5034c9951940f68cb6
1 Input
1 Output
-
3c66d69ffcca4fcf1b5f577695526226d076829db11d4d5034c9951940f68cb6:0
- value
- 41172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2236184180ae1aeae3b82d47d445e29be5a1ceb3 OP_EQUAL
- address
- 34ouhdnePK57qDoW4BhAWxCrhu7kFbVF7Q